About Bo Zhao

Bo Zhao is a scholar working on Energy Engineering and Power Technology, Control and Systems Engineering and Electrical and Electronic Engineering, having authored 74 papers that have together received 752 indexed citations. Recurring topics across this work include Electric Motor Design and Analysis (18 papers), Magnetic Properties and Applications (14 papers) and Electromagnetic Launch and Propulsion Technology (13 papers). The work is most often cited by research in Control and Systems Engineering (232 citations), Electrical and Electronic Engineering (542 citations) and Bioengineering (39 citations). Bo Zhao has collaborated with scholars based in China, Australia and Italy. Frequent co-authors include Jibin Zou, Yongxiang Xu, Lili Zheng, Hui Zhang, Pengyue Zhao, Xu Ma, Qian Wang, Chenlei Wang, Cheng Wang and Mei Yan. Their work appears in journals such as IEEE Transactions on Power Electronics, International Journal of Hydrogen Energy and IEEE Access.
